Harrisonville is a city in Pennsylvania, located in Fulton County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 1,113 residents. It is a relatively young city, with a median age of 33.7 years.
Economically, Harrisonville is a solidly middle-class community. The median household income of $69,688 is near the national average. Approximately 14.1%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 1.4%, well below the national average.
The real estate market in Harrisonville is an affordable housing market. Median home values stand at $177,900, which is below the national average. Renters typically pay around $728 per month. Homeownership is high at 80.8%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.
The population of Harrisonville is moderately educated. 25.9%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— below the national average. The community is primarily White (95.24%).
